Richard Lee Winton

Born: July 4, 1942
Passed: March 5, 2020
Funeral Home: Speck Funeral Home
Funeral Services for Mr. Richard Lee Winton, age 77, of Livingston will be conducted 2 p.m., Sunday, March 8, 2020 from the chapel of Speck Funeral Home. Burial to follow in the Green Hill Cemetery. The family will welcome friends on Saturday evening from 5 until 9 p.m., then on Sunday from 11 a.m. until time of services. Richard passed from this life on Thursday evening, March 5, 2020 from the Livingston Regional Hospital. He was born in Overton County, Tennessee on July 4, 1942 to the late Robert Leslie & Helen Gray Copeland Winton. Richard was a 1960 graduate of Livingston Academy. He loved collecting old cars, building, buying, and selling houses. Most of all, Richard loved his family and spending time with them.
